Update: Norfolk County D.A. Still Hospitalized Following Multi-Car Accident

Norfolk County District Attorney Michael Morrissey crossed the double yellow line on Centre Street in Milton on Tuesday evening causing a four-vehicle accident.

Update written by Adam Roberts of Patch:

Norfolk County District Attorney Michael W. Morrissey remains hospitalized after he crossed the double yellow line on Centre Street in Milton around 5:50 p.m. on Tuesday, July 17.

According to Milton Deputy Police Chief John King, Morrissey had just left his Canton office and was traveling to his home in Quincy when his vehicle collided with two other vehicles in the westbound lane. A fourth vehicle swerved to avoid the accident, driving off the roadway.

King said the reason the District Attorney crossed the center line is unknown.

Milton Police issued motor vehicle citations to two operators related to the incident, but the charges are unknown at this time.

"I do not comment on the identities or charges of individuals who have a right to be heard on those citations in court first," said King.

According to the Milton Police Log, two people were transported to Beth Israel Deaconess Hospital-Milton and two others were taken to Boston Medical Center.

King did not indicate what hospitals any of the patents were taken to but said three people were treated and released, but Morrissey remained hospitalized Wednesday afternoon for treatment and observation.

Morrissey, 58, was elected Norfolk County D.A. in 2010.  Canton is one of 28 communities in Norfolk County.

Original Story - The following is written by Matt Perkins of Patch:

Norfolk County District Attorney Michael W. Morrissey and three other individuals were injured in a multi-vehicle accident Tuesday evening. 

The accident occurred shortly before 6 p.m. on Centre Street in Milton. Officers and medical professionals responded to the scene and treated parties injured in the crash, according to a statement from Morrissey's Office. The others injured in the crash were treated at area hospitals and released. 

Morrissey was also transported by ambulance to an area hospital, where he was treated for injuries he sustained in the crash, and remains hospitalized for further testing and observation.  

"I am very concerned about the well-being of the other parties injured in the accident," Morrissey said in a statement.
